Sri Vijaya Puram, Feb. 25: A State-Level Training Programme on ‘Model Women Friendly Gram Panchayat (MWFGP)’ was conducted by the Directorate of RD, PRIs & ULBs in its SPRC Training Hall today. The initiative aims to ensure the active participation of women in decision-making processes and to enhance institutional mechanisms for effectively addressing women-related issues at the grassroots level.
Ms. C. Vijya, Domain Expert (Women Empowerment) emphasized on the importance of building gender-sensitive governance structures within PRIs. Smti. Mariam, Sub Inspector, A&N Police highlighted various legal provisions available for the protection of women and discussed the proactive role of law enforcement agencies in ensuring a secure environment for women and girls. Ms Rukhsar Rahim, Para Legal Counselor, Department of Social Welfare, conducted an informative session on legal aid services and support systems available to women.
